G606 OMX is a 1989 Audi 80 in White with a 1,781c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.
Across all 1989 Audi 80 models, the average MOT pass rate is 62.6% with a typical mileage of 130,763 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Audi 80 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 17,695 recorded failures. If you're considering buying G606 OMX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Audi 80 typ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 37 years old, this Audi 80 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
